var path = Core.FindDataFile("client.exe", false);
using (FileStream fs = new FileStream(path, FileMode.Open, FileAccess.Read, FileShare.Read))
{
var buffer = new byte[fs.Length];
fs.Read(buffer, 0, buffer.Length);
// VS_VERSION_INFO (unicode)
Span<byte> vsVersionInfo = stackalloc byte[]
{
0x56, 0x00, 0x53, 0x00, 0x5F, 0x00, 0x56, 0x00,
0x45, 0x00, 0x52, 0x00, 0x53, 0x00, 0x49, 0x00,
0x4F, 0x00, 0x4E, 0x00, 0x5F, 0x00, 0x49, 0x00,
0x4E, 0x00, 0x46, 0x00, 0x4F, 0x00
};
for (var i = 0; i < buffer.Length - 30; i++)
{
if (vsVersionInfo.SequenceEqual(buffer.AsSpan(i, 30)))
{
var offset = i + 30 + 12;
var minorPart = BinaryPrimitives.ReadUInt16LittleEndian(buffer.AsSpan(offset));
var majorPart = BinaryPrimitives.ReadUInt16LittleEndian(buffer.AsSpan(offset + 2));
var privatePart = BinaryPrimitives.ReadUInt16LittleEndian(buffer.AsSpan(offset + 4));
var buildPart = BinaryPrimitives.ReadUInt16LittleEndian(buffer.AsSpan(offset + 6));
return new ClientVersion(majorPart, minorPart, buildPart, privatePart);
}
}
}
